Comprehending the 45ft Container

These containers are 45 feet (13.72 meters) in length, 8 feet (2.44 meters) in width, and 9 feet 6 inches (2.9 meters) in height. They are mainly utilized in marine and rail transportation, offering an additional 5 feet (1.52 meters) of length over the 40-foot container.

Benefits of 45ft Containers

  1. Increased Capacity:

    • Higher Volume: The additional 5 feet of length enables a substantial increase in the volume of products that can be transported. This is especially helpful for bulk deliveries, where every cubic foot counts.
    • Reduced Handling: Fewer containers indicate less handling operations, which can reduce the danger of damage and lower labor expenses.
  2. Cost Efficiency:

    • Economies of Scale: Transporting more goods in a single container typically results in lower per-unit shipping costs.
    • Enhanced Load: The larger capacity can help enhance the usage of space, minimizing the requirement for additional journeys and saving money on fuel and operational expenses.
  3. Versatility in Transport:

    • Multi-modal: 45-foot containers can be quickly carried by sea, rail, and roadway, making them a flexible alternative for international and domestic deliveries.
    • Customizable: These containers can be modified to fit specific cargo requirements, such as refrigerated systems for perishable items or open-top containers for oversized products.
  4. Environmental Impact:

    • Reduced Emissions: By transporting more products in less journeys, 45-foot containers can add to a decrease in carbon emissions and other pollutants.
    • Sustainable Practices: Many logistics business are adopting bigger containers as part of their sustainability efforts to reduce the environmental footprint of their operations.

Applications of 45ft Containers

  1. Marine Shipping:

    • International Trade: 45-foot containers are commonly used in international trade, particularly for paths where bigger volumes of items are transported.
    • Transoceanic Routes: These containers are ideal for transoceanic routes, where the extra capacity can lead to considerable cost savings.
  2. Rail Transport:

    • Domestic Transport: In countries with extensive rail networks, 45-foot containers are used for efficient domestic transportation of products.
    • Cross-border Shipping: They are likewise suitable for cross-border rail shipping, especially in regions with standardized rail assesses.
  3. Road Transport:

    • Long-distance Haulage: For long-distance road haulage, 45-foot Durable 45ft containers can be filled onto specialized trailers, making them a practical option for bulk deliveries.
    • Urban Distribution: While not as typical in urban locations due to size restrictions, 45-foot containers can be utilized for last-mile distribution when moved to smaller lorries.
  4. Specialized Cargo:

    • Refrigerated Goods: Refrigerated 45-foot containers, called reefers, are utilized for carrying disposable items such as fruits, veggies, and pharmaceuticals.
    • Oversized Items: Open-top 45-foot containers offer the flexibility needed for transferring large and heavy items, such as equipment and building products.

Factors To Consider for Using 45ft Containers

  1. Regulatory Compliance:

    • Dimensions and Weight: It is vital to comply with regional and international guidelines concerning container dimensions and weight limitations.
    • Documentation: Proper paperwork, consisting of expenses of lading and customizeds statements, is needed to make sure smooth transportation and avoid hold-ups.
  2. Handling and Storage:

    • Terminal Facilities: Ports and terminals must have the essential infrastructure to manage 45-foot containers, including cranes and storage locations.
    • Packing and Unloading: Specialized equipment may be needed for loading and dumping 45-foot containers, especially for extra-large and heavy cargo.
  3. Transport Costs:

    • Freight Rates: While the cost per unit might be lower, the total freight rates for 45-foot containers can be greater due to their size.
    • Fuel Consumption: Larger Heavy-duty 45ft containers may need more fuel for transport, which can offset some of the cost savings.
  4. Logistics Planning:

    • Route Analysis: Careful route analysis is necessary to guarantee that 45-foot containers can be transferred effectively without coming across size or weight restrictions.
    • Cost-Benefit Analysis: A comprehensive cost-benefit analysis needs to be conducted to identify if the increased capacity validates the additional costs and complexities.

FAQs About 45ft Containers

Q: How much more cargo can a 45-foot container hold compared to a 40-foot container?

  • A: A 45-foot container can hold around 15% more cargo than a standard 40-foot container. This extra capacity is especially helpful for bulk deliveries and can lead to cost savings.

Q: Are 45-foot containers more costly to deliver than smaller sized containers?

  • A: While the cost per unit might be lower, the total freight rates for 45-foot containers can be higher due to their size and the specific devices needed for managing. However, the increased capacity frequently justifies the additional expenses.

Q: Can 45-foot containers be used for all types of cargo?

  • A: 45-foot containers are flexible and can be utilized for a wide variety of cargo, consisting of bulk goods, cooled products, and large items. Nevertheless, particular kinds of cargo might need customized modifications to the container.

Q: Are there any size or weight constraints for 45-foot containers?

  • A: Yes, there specify size and weight constraints for 45-foot containers, which differ by region. It is necessary to examine regional and worldwide regulations to make sure compliance.

Q: How do 45-foot containers contribute to sustainability in logistics?

  • A: By transferring more products in fewer trips, 45-foot containers can lower the number of automobiles required for transport, causing lower fuel intake and carbon emissions. Numerous logistics companies are adopting bigger containers as part of their sustainability initiatives.
